Haha the pace monsters! I've got some sat in my old ladies garage, nearly brand new.

I did have the pace dh bike snapped one and cracked the frame at the bottom of the other one. Ended up going to pace in the north yorkshire moors and kicking off over £3k I paid for it. I did recieve a refund on the price of the frame \o/ (when I was there the welder even told me that it was a shite design.)

My first bike was the san andreas think there was only 3 in the country when I got it. Rob Warner had one and another guy down south. Still have it to this day. It has all of about 3" of travel. I think is was one of the first full on dh rigs apart from the proflex, GT RTS. My old mans still got the san andreas, uses it to go to shop on hahahah! even has the orginal bright yellow magura hydraulic brakes and XTR.

How things have changed!
